Essentials
Designer | Britton Chance Jr. (USA) | |
Builders | Oy Vator, Vator Oy AB. Helsinki (FIN) | |
Material | Mahogany, carvel planked | |
1st certificate issued | 1963 | |
Original boat name | Complex V | |
Original country | USA | |
Original sail number | 051 | |
Current location | Tall Timbers, MD (USA) |

- Complex V US-51 - 06.11.2014 by Matti Muoniovaara
- Complex is Vator boat #753 built 1963 for Dr. Britton Chance. Those days Jr. was an amateur designer. It's the first design of young Brit.
Rossi's boat is this boat. - Complex V, US-51 - 01.08.2013 by Daniel Rossi
- This was the first Britton Chance, Jr. 5.5 design that was built. - July, 1970 Sports Illustrated Article.
G. Cox raced Complex V in the 1965 Worlds (Italy) and took 3rd place/Bronze. - Original sails for several of the Complex series boats owned by Dr. Britton Chance - 28.02.2009 by Rex Howland
- Dr. Chance has given me several of the original sails for the Complex series of 5.5 metre boats he owned. They include sails for Complex III, Complex V, and Complex VI. All of these sails can still be used (at least for historical purposes).
Rex Howland - Designer of Complex V - 03.06.2008 by Rex Howland
- Britton Chance Jr. was the designer of Complex V.
5.5 metre sailboats with name of Complex were:
Complex II US - 1 built in 1952
Complex III US - 21 built in 1959
Complex V US - 51 built in 1963
Complex VI US - 78 built in 1968
Note: Complex II name came from biological discovery made by Dr.Britton Chance.
In addition, the Chance family sailed on State 6 US - 58 built in 1964.
